You can wrap all the summer fun into one trip with a stay at the Marina Grand Resort, one of the best options for on-the-water accommodations in the area. New Buffalo is chock-full of summer fun, and this is an incredible basecamp to experience them all. Rest assured you can expect a comfortable rest at the end of a long day.
This full-service waterfront resort not only caters to those looking for a getaway in Michigan, but its proximity to the Tri-State area makes it a popular option for travelers in Indiana and Chicago.
Those traveling from the Windy City won’t have to drive more than 1.5 hours to find their escape across the shoreline. The Amtrack also runs through New Buffalo, making this a destination you can reach by rail.
Find me a resort on our list of Best Places To Stay In Michigan that lets you park your boat right outside your room. This is a sailor’s dream destination where you’ll find slips lining the beautiful view over Lake Michigan.
From basic guest rooms to suits, all your options will come with a beautiful view of Lake Michigan. The rooms are renovated with several accents that complement the natural beauty of the lakeshore.
This resort is full of unique amenities that take advantage of the natural beauty surrounding the property. Find your inner peace with some yoga on the back lawn or gaze out at the endless waters during a stunning sunset. If you’re not a big fan of swimming in the lake, there’s also an indoor and outdoor pool where you can soak.
If you’re traveling with children, there’s a game room that serves as a great distraction for energetic kids. Just don’t tell them about the Ben & Jerry’s Hotline, which brings some of your favorite ice cream flavors right to your door. I’d keep that one a surprise that you can pull out whenever your kids deserve an unexpected reward.
There are some classic dining options in New Buffalo including the Stray Dog Bar and Grill and Redamack’s, but you can also find great food within arms reach from your room at the Marina Grand Resort. Bentwood Tavern specializes in great Michigan beer, artfully crafted cocktails, and elevated tavern fare.
You’ll feel like a character in a Hemingway novel surrounded by the wood-clad and leather-upholstered interior. I can definitely settle into a good book and enjoy an old-fashioned in a place like this.
